We use solid brass terminal posts or plated screws to enable good RF, electrical, and
mechanical connections between the BALUN terminal posts, and the antenna wire.
Our BALUNS employ both, and/or Ferrite and powdered Iron cores. Unless otherwise stated, our BALUNS
are Current type and all www.PacketRadio.com. BALUNS are made in the USA.
Ring terminals are silver plated bronze to prevent oxidation caused by dissimilar metal contact.
We made the antenna screw connection at right angles to make antenna screws easy to tighten
without turning the solid brass terminal. All terminal posts and connectors are installed with tin plated
lock-washers between each metal or case contact surface. By using tin-plated lock-washers, we further
provide better metal to metal contact for better RF transfer of energy to the antenna.
